What drives Reno pricing

Local labor

Licensed trade labor in Reno runs about 106% of the national average, and the best crews book out fastest in spring and early summer.

Permits & code

Most Reno, NV projects that change structure, electrical, plumbing or mechanical systems need a permit from the local building department; cosmetic work usually does not.

Ways to save in Reno

  • Keep plumbing near existing lines to cut trenching cost.
  • Confirm parking requirements before design — some cities require a replacement space.
  • Collect three written bids on an identical scope — spreads of 20–40% are normal.
  • Book in the off-season and stay flexible on the start date to save 5–15%.
  • Bundle nearby work into one mobilization so you only pay setup and travel once.
  • Ask what the contractor would change to cut 10% without hurting durability.
